GPJA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review
3 of the 4,410 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Georgia Power Company Series 2017A 5.00% Junior Subordinated Notes due Oct 1 2077 (GPJA)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$2.15M — down 30% from $3.07M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of GPJA and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 1 trimmed existing stakes and 0 added.
The largest seller was PVG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$754K sold.
